Surgical correction of hyperkeratosis in the Papillon-Lefèvre syndrome
Abstract:
In a severe case of the Papillon-Lefèvre syndrome, surgical correction of the disabling hyperkeratosis on the dorsa of the hands was first tested in a small area and, when that proved successful, the entire dorsa of both hands were resurfaced. The result was functionally gratifying and the cosmetic appearance was improved.
